Some of the most dangerous ice on the lake when it does firm up due to the cold will be out of Port Bolster and Cooks....

Cooks cause of the ice resuce and and the new channel's carved out by the ice boats.

But PB will be unsafe cause there are tons of holes out there that have been drilled and are likely 24" wide now. So the ice near might firm up well and then the holes will have a skim or a few inches of ice.
